Jun 20, 2008Trouble obtaining pool members.
Here's my problem:
I'm trying to use iControl to obtain the ip and port information of all members of a specific pool. I'm using Python and the SOAPpy module for my script.
When I connect to the LTM to collect this information, it appears that iControl is returning a list containing an empty list, rather than a list containing a list containing a struct for each pool member.
Below is the code fragment in question, and below that is the output of the fragment.
Script fragment:
db_proxy = SOAPpy.SOAPProxy(url, ICONTROL_POOL_NAMESPACE)
pool_members = db_proxy.get_member(pool_names["http_pool_8633"])
print pool_members
print len(pool_members)
print pool_members[ 0 ]
print len(pool_members[ 0 ])
Script output:
[root@host ~]$ ./GetPoolMembers.py
: [[]]
1
: []
0
Any suggestions?
I've checked the obvious things (I think) like 'are we connecting to the correct LTM', 'is the pool name correct' and 'does the pool contain any members'.
